**Runbook: ReceiptRelay account recovery**

When the ReceiptRelay mailer account locks out — usually after the donation-receipt batch hits the send-rate ceiling — support can restore it without escalating. Confirm the batch queue is paused, then open the mailer admin page and choose "Recover service account." The system will prompt once; do not retry on failure, escalate instead. Enter the recovery passphrase shown below at the prompt.

vault phrase of bagaf-kajeg = jorath-feniel-briir-siliel-ralix

Subject: Key rotation for InvoiceForge renderer

Welcome, new folks. Every quarter we rotate the credential the Pellworth PDF invoice renderer uses to call our internal asset service, Vaultline. The old key stops working Friday at noon. Update your local .env and the staging config before then, and verify a test invoice renders with the new embedded fonts. For convenience, the freshly issued key is included here.

app token of bagef-bageg = kto11_vuwA0uhrEMg

Subject: Handover — DiagramDen undo/redo store

Hi Marek,

Before I roll off, here's the state of the undo/redo persistence for DiagramDen. Each editor action is written as an append-only event in the `op_log` table; redo is just replay from a checkpoint, so never delete rows mid-session. The compaction job runs hourly and is safe to pause during migrations. Watch the `op_log` growth after large imports — it spikes hard. For verification queries, connect to the history database with the connection string below.

Best,
Ivona

primary connection of tawif-yajeg = postgresql://rusiel_svc:G879q9cx6GsSvj@db-dd9f.norvagrid.internal:5432/casath

Graphlark, our dependency graph visualizer, previously rendered SVGs in-process. As of version 3, rendering is delegated to the Plumefield render service, which handles layout for graphs above 5,000 nodes without freezing the browser. New team members: you only need to update the client config; the render service itself is managed by the platform group. After updating, verify that large graphs load in under three seconds on staging. The staging render service expects the configuration values below.

deployment values, yadug-bawif:
[framir]
team = pelox
access_code = ac_a38ab2
owner = tamion.julael
host = framir.tolvaqlabs.test
port = 11211
peer = tammir.zemvargrid.local
salt = 2215ef03
pin = 1541